Emergency End (E-Stop) switches are critical security products used throughout numerous industries to promptly halt machinery and equipment throughout emergencies. These switches are intended to reduce mishaps, guard personnel, and safeguard machines by delivering a right away indicates of stopping operations. Here is a more in-depth check out what E-Halt switches are, their significance, And exactly how they perform.

What exactly are Unexpected emergency End (E-Prevent) Switches?
E-Stop switches are manually operated gadgets that, when activated, straight away cut off electricity to machinery or gear. These switches are typically vivid crimson by using a yellow history, making them easily identifiable within an unexpected emergency. They are strategically positioned in available places to be certain they can be promptly achieved when essential.

How E-Cease Switches Get the job done
Activation: When an E-Stop change is pressed, it interrupts the ability (E-Stop) Switches offer into the equipment, leading to it to halt instantly. This interruption is often achieved through numerous mechanisms, for example breaking an electrical circuit or triggering a relay.

Reset: Just after an E-Stop swap has been activated, it has to be manually reset prior to the devices is often restarted. This reset process ensures that the cause of the emergency is addressed before functions resume, thereby preventing further incidents.

Design Attributes: E-Quit switches are created to be fail-safe, this means they can functionality effectively even while in the occasion of a power failure or mechanical malfunction. Also they are developed to withstand severe environments, producing them trustworthy in different industrial configurations.

Sorts of E-End Switches
Press-Pull E-Quit Switches: These switches are activated by pushing the button and reset by pulling it back out. They are generally used in many apps because of their simplicity and trustworthiness.

Twist-Release E-Halt Switches: To reset these switches, the button has to be twisted. This style helps prevent accidental resets and assures intentionality in Emergency Stop (E-Stop) Switches restarting the gear.

Key-Launch E-Stop Switches: These switches demand a vital to reset, giving an additional amount of security and Management above the equipment. They in many cases are used in superior-security or limited-access regions.
